Introduction of Aluminum Casting Processes



Aluminum casting procedures incorporate a variety of methods utilized to shape molten aluminum into wanted kinds. These methods consist of sand casting, die spreading, and investment spreading, each offering unique benefits depending on the application (Aluminum Casting). Sand spreading entails producing a mold and mildew from sand, permitting elaborate styles and big parts, while die spreading uses high pressure to inject molten aluminum into steel molds, making certain accuracy and smooth finishes. Financial investment casting, additionally referred to as lost-wax casting, produces intricate forms with superb dimensional accuracy, making it suitable for thorough parts


These procedures are characterized by their ability to produce light-weight, sturdy parts that exhibit superb corrosion resistance. The versatility of aluminum enables personalization in numerous markets, from auto to aerospace. Additionally, the capacity to reuse aluminum improves the sustainability of these casting processes, reducing environmental impact while preserving material honesty. Recognizing these techniques is important for enhancing manufacturing efficiency and accomplishing premium aluminum castings.

Alloy Variants Effect



The structure of aluminum alloys greatly influences their rust resistance homes in castings. Various alloy variants, such as 1xxx, 2xxx, and 6xxx collection, show distinct degrees of sensitivity to deterioration. 1xxx alloys, primarily composed of pure aluminum, deal exceptional rust resistance due to their high purity. On the other hand, 2xxx alloys, which consist of copper, might experience significant deterioration when subjected to severe settings. On the other hand, 6xxx alloys, including magnesium and silicon, strike a balance in between stamina and resistance. The existence of alloying aspects can improve or decrease safety oxide layers, eventually influencing durability and performance. Understanding these variants is essential for picking the ideal alloy for specific applications where deterioration resistance is essential.

Contrast With Various Other Casting Materials



While various casting products each have their one-of-a-kind advantages, aluminum regularly shows superior homes that make it a recommended selection in lots of applications. Contrasted to iron and steel, aluminum is considerably lighter, which decreases the general weight of completed items, enhancing gas performance in automobile and aerospace sectors. In addition, aluminum offers outstanding rust resistance, calling for much less maintenance over time contrasted to products like iron, which can rust.


When juxtaposed with plastics, aluminum's toughness and resilience exceed lots of synthetic alternatives, making it ideal for demanding environments. Furthermore, aluminum's thermal and electrical conductivity is extremely higher than many various other metals, making it suitable for applications requiring efficient warmth dissipation or electric parts.
